     kinds of scholarships are out there for 2025?

Broadly, they fall into a few categories to suit different needs:

  • Undergraduate Scholarships in Nigeria: These are for fresh high school grads or direct entry students. They often reward high JAMB scores, academic excellence, or community service. Examples include merit awards for top performers in STEM fields.
  • Postgraduate Scholarships: Aimed at master’s or PhD hopefuls, these can be fully funded and cover research costs. They’re perfect if you’re advancing your career in fields like engineering or health.
  • Fully Funded Scholarships in Nigerian Universities: The holy grail—these pay for everything, from fees to stipends. Government and corporate sponsors like NNPC or MTN often back them.
  • Merit-Based vs. Need-Based: Merit ones go to high achievers (think CGPA 3.5+), while need-based help those from low-income families. Some blend both, like sports scholarships for talented athletes.
  • Industry-Specific Awards: Oil companies, tech firms, and NGOs offer these for fields like petroleum engineering or IT, tying into Nigeria’s economy.

Many of these are open to students at public or private universities, but the top schools often have dedicated programs or partnerships that make them stand out. 1. University of Lagos (UNILAG) – A Hub for Diverse Scholarship Opportunities

UNILAG, fondly called the “University of First Choice,” is one of the best federal universities in Nigeria, known for its bustling campus in Akoka, Lagos. It’s a top pick for scholarships because of its strong ties to international and local funders. In 2025, UNILAG students can access a mix of internal and external awards, making it ideal for those seeking fully funded scholarships in Nigeria.

Key scholarships include the 2025 MOE Taiwan Scholarship Program, which covers tuition up to USD 1,250 per semester for undergrad, master’s, or PhD programs. It’s open to UNILAG students with good academic standing, and the duration varies (4 years for undergrad, 2 for master’s). Then there’s the UNILAG AEP Scholarship for Esan indigenes in 200 level and above with a CGPA of 3.0+. It provides financial aid to ease study burdens.

Don’t miss the DAAD Masters Wits-TUB-UNILAG Scholarship, fully funded for African candidates in urban studies—covers tuition, stipend, travel, and medical aid. Eligibility? Strong academics and motivation for sustainable development.

To apply: Head to UNILAG’s official site for notices, or check portals like Scholastica for partnered awards. Deadlines often fall between January and August 2025, so apply now to beat the rush. UNILAG’s career center also posts updates on internships tied to scholarships, like MTN opportunities. 2. University of Ibadan (UI) – Nigeria’s Premier Institution with Generous Grants

As Nigeria’s oldest university, UI in Oyo State stands tall for its academic rigor and research focus. It’s a magnet for scholarships in Nigeria 2025, especially for undergraduates from the southwest. UI emphasizes merit, so if you have stellar grades, you’re in luck.

Standout is the BOVAS Undergraduate Scholarship 2025, fully funded for 200-level students with a CGPA of 3.5+ from specific states (Oyo, Osun, etc.). It covers fees for the full program duration. UI also hosts the MINDS Scholarship Programme for leadership development and the NHEF Scholarship for penultimate-year students.

For postgrads, there’s the Fully Funded Scholarship for Postgraduate Study, open to residents of Nigeria and other African countries, covering tuition and stipends. Eligibility includes residency proof and academic excellence.

Application tips: Visit UI’s scholarship page for forms—deadlines like July 25, 2025, for BOVAS. Combine with federal awards for extra support. 3. Ahmadu Bello University (ABU) – Northern Powerhouse for Funded Studies

Located in Zaria, Kaduna, ABU is a giant in northern Nigeria, excelling in agriculture, engineering, and medicine. It’s renowned for scholarships targeting northern students, making it a go-to for fully funded opportunities in 2025.

The Ahmadu Bello Foundation Scholarship 2025 supports 200 undergrads and HND students from northern states, providing financial aid from 100 or 200 level. Eligibility: Admission via UTME or direct entry, plus residency proof. The foundation screens applicants at ABU, with awards for the 2024/2025 session ongoing into 2025.

ABU partners with NHEF for penultimate-year scholarships in partner unis, offering stipends and skill-building. Also, check OPay Scholarship for ₦300,000 one-time aid.

How to apply now: Submit via the foundation’s portal by August deadlines. ABU’s site lists verification exercises—don’t miss them. With its vast campus, ABU fosters innovation, perfect for scholarship recipients aiming for impactful careers.

4. Covenant University – Private Excellence with International Flair

Covenant University in Ota, Ogun State, is a leading private school in Nigeria, known for its faith-based ethos and high employability rates. It’s tops for scholarships in 2025, especially for international and STEM students.

The Covenant University International Excellence Scholarship targets non-Nigerian master’s applicants, lasting 18 months across programs. Then, the CApIC-ACE Scholarship funds master’s and PhD in bioinformatics, computer science, etc., via World Bank support—fully funded for West African applicants.

Eligibility: Strong academics and motivation; open to Nigerians too for CApIC.

Apply: Through Covenant’s portal—links lead to detailed forms. Deadlines vary, but start early for September 2025 intake. Covenant’s modern facilities make it a dream for scholars.

5. Nile University – Affordable Private Education with Discounts Galore

In Abuja, Nile University blends Turkish and Nigerian curricula, making it attractive for scholarships in Nigeria 2025. It’s great for those seeking academic and sports awards.

Undergrad scholarships based on JAMB: 10-100% off for scores 250+, plus A-Level bonuses. Postgrad: 50% for first-class Nile grads. Sports scholarships offer 100% for national athletes representing Nile.

Sibling and institution discounts add value—up to 20% off.

Eligibility: Maintain CGPA 3.50; apply at entry point.

How to apply now: Via Nile’s admissions portal—first-come, first-served. Ideal for families or groups.

6. University of Nigeria Nsukka (UNN) – Eastern Gem for Research Scholarships

UNN in Enugu is famed for its lion spirit and strong programs in arts and sciences. In 2025, it’s a hotspot for government-backed scholarships.

Students here access Federal Scholarship Board awards: ₦300,000-450,000 annually for undergrad/postgrad in public unis. Also, NNPC/SNEPCo for second-year students with CGPA 3.5+.

Apply via Scholastica by August 29, 2025. UNN’s vibrant community supports scholars well.

7. Obafemi Awolowo University (OAU) – Innovation-Driven with Merit Awards

In Ile-Ife, OAU shines for architecture and law. Scholarships include MTN Science & Technology (₦300,000/year for 300-level STEM) and for blind students.

Eligibility: CGPA 3.0+; public uni students.

Apply through MTN portal. OAU’s tech focus boosts employability.
